3131 University Dr Nw Huntsville Alabama
When you stay at Suburban Extended Stay Hotel Huntsville University Area in Huntsville, you'll be near the airport, within a 5-minute drive of Huntsville Depot Museum and Huntsville Museum of Art. Featured amenities include a 24-hour front desk, laundry facilities, and an elevator. Free self parking is available onsite.